Nitrous oxide waveguide laser

Journal Article · · Sov. J. Quant. Electron. (Engl. Transl.); (United States)
An experimental study was made of an N/sub 2/O waveguide laser with a BeO discharge tube with a diameter 2 mm. The dependences of the output power of the laser radiation on the density of the pump current and on the rate of circulation of gas mixtures of different compositions were determined. The maximum power near the 10.8 ..mu.. wavelength was 95 mW when the average pressure in the active medium was 2.9 kPa (the composition of the mixture was 4% Xe, 12% N/sub 2/O, 26% N/sub 2/, and 58% He).
